This is an application for suspension of substantive jail sentence and for grant of bail. 2.
Heard learned counsel Shri Bhushan Sachdeva for the applicant and learned Additional Public Prosecutor Shri V.A.Thakare for the State. Also, perused judgment and order of conviction, impugned in the present appeal. 3.
By judgment and order dated 15.11.2019 passed by learned Additional Sessions Judge, Amravati in Special (POCSO) Case No.69/2018 though learned Judge of .....2/-
the Court below acquitted the applicant of offence punishable under Section 7 read with Section 8 of the Protection of Children from Sexual Offences Act, 2012, convicted the applicant for offence punishable under Section 354-A(1)(i) read with Section 354-A(2) of the Indian Penal Code and sentenced to suffer rigorous imprisonment for 1 year and to pay a fine of Rs.5000/- and in default of payment of the fine amount to suffer simple imprisonment for 1 month.
4.
The applicant was on bail during the course of the trial. Submission is made on affidavit that after order of conviction, the sentence stood suspended by learned Judge of the Court below.
5.
In this view of the matter, I pass following order:
ORDER
(1) The criminal application is allowed.
(2) The substantive jail sentence imposed upon the applicant, by judgment and order dated 15.11.2019 passed by learned Additional Sessions Judge, Amravati in Special (POCSO) Case No.69/2018, shall stand suspended during the pendency of the present appeal.
(3) The applicant be released on bail on he executing a P.R.Bond in the sum of Rs.10,000/- with one solvent surety of the like amount. The applicant shall execute fresh bond .....3/-
before learned Judge of the Court below within a period of one month from today.
With this, the criminal application stands disposed of accordingly.
